This pair of "cloverleaf lace" socks kick off the year-long Six Sox Knit-Along. I used stretchy cotton/elastic Cascade Fixation and a 2.5mm circular needle. These were knit from the cuff down (c.o. 60 sts.), with a short-row heel on 60% of the stitches (36 sts.). I'm not crazy about this bright green, and I wasn't crazy about the Fixation. It makes a nice squishy fabric, but I probably won't knit with it again.
